From: In silico prioritisation of candidate genes for prokaryotic gene function discovery: an application of phylogenetic profiles

Figure 1

The performance of statistical CGP in rediscovering peptidoglycan-related genes (amss scoring function). The box-and-whisker plot shows the result of statistical CGP (amss scoring function) in rediscovering peptidoglycan-related genes in the two study genomes (Streptococcus agalactiae 2603 and Escherichia coli K-12). The horizontal bars indicate medians of the prioritised ranks and the boxes indicate the upper and lower quartiles. Groups C, B, and M indicate 3 sets of validation genes used. Genes from the glycolytic pathways were used as controls for comparison.
